PHOTO / Editor Picks |
Photos from regional media in 2006Updated: 2007-01-18 09:13 Law enforcement workers try to catch a street dog in Chengdu, Southwest China's Sichuan Province, July 11, 2006. The local government launched a 14-day campaign to get rid of the street dogs. [Guo Guangyu/Chengdu Commercial News]
|
|